While it's true that Jimmy formed the band (with JPJ), and appointed Robert as vocalist and Bonzo on Robert's recommendation.

After the first album it was more Page and Plant as far as the songwriting goes. However, whilst JP was the producer JPJ was the mastermind behind the arrangements.

Plant was always going to make it regardless of Zeppelin, it's just that joining up with Jimmy and co., merely accelerated the inevitable.

Plant deserves the accolades he gets and if you think he cares what you, me or anyone else thinks of his decision or what his motives are, think again.

I certainly do what I think is right for me and my family regardless of what anybody else would prefer I do.

People who are overly influenced by other people are no better than sheep.

Whether you like it or not JP has had many opportunities over the years to do live gigs.

He has done a few collaborations on occasion and movie soundtracks as you well know.

As for not liking bluegrass or country you don't have an ally in Jimmy on that score.

Led Zeppelin were definitely into it and recorded it in tribute too.

These songs have a strong country lilt to them:

Bron-Y-aur Stomp

Hey Hey What Can I do

Tangerine

Down By The Seaside

Hot Dog

There may be others that don't come to mind right now.

Published images, unless specifically labeled, are not in the public domain; they are the intelectual property of the person who made the image (unless that was done during the course of someone's employment - i.e., comissioned work), and consequently protected by law. A print firm is not going to risk substantial financial damages that may be incurred by unlawful reproduction of said images without the permission of the owner, whether or not you intend it for personal use or for gainful profit. They have no way of knowing what your real intentions will be.

Images in books, magazines, posters - or for that matter - the internet, are subject to copyright unless labeled as royalty free.
